Resultados da pesquisa a pedido "portability"

5 a resposta

Usando snprintf em um aplicativo de plataforma cruzada

Estou escrevendo um programa em C que deve ser compilado com todos os principais compiladores. Atualmente, estou desenvolvendo no GCC em uma máquina Linux e compilando no MSVC antes de confirmar o código. Para facilitar a compilação cruzada, ...

4 a resposta

Python: import _io

Estou tentando determinar quais arquivos da biblioteca Python são estritamente necessários para a execução do meu script. No momento, estou tentando determinar onde _io.py está localizado. No io.py (sem sublinhado), o módulo _io.py ...

1 a resposta

Operador de pré-processador _Pragma no Visual C ++

Existe algo como o operador ANSI C_Pragma no Visual C ++? Por exemplo, estou tentando definir a seguinte macro: #ifdef _OPENMP #define PRAGMA_IF_OPENMP(x) _Pragma (#x) #else // #ifdef _OPENMP #define PRAGMA_IF_OPENMP(x) #endif // #ifdef ...

4 a resposta

Qual é a maneira mais simples de escrever bibliotecas portáteis dinamicamente carregáveis em C ++?

Estou trabalhando em um projeto que possui vários caminhos de código semelhantes que eu gostaria de separar do projeto principal em plugins. O projeto deve permanecer compatível com várias plataformas, e todas as APIs de carregamento ...

7 a resposta

O posicionamento novo para matrizes pode ser usado de maneira portátil?

É possível usar o posicionamento novo em código portátil ao usá-lo para matrizes?Parece que o ponteiro que você recebe de novo [] não é sempre o mesmo que o ...

7 a resposta

Caminhos Unix: funciona oficialmente em Python para qualquer plataforma?

2 a resposta

A enum nunca deve ser usada em uma API?

Estou usando uma biblioteca C fornecida para mim já compilada. Eu tenho informações limitadas sobre o compilador, versão, opções etc. usadas na compilação da biblioteca. A interface da biblioteca usaenum em estruturas que são passadas e ...

3 a resposta

PHP - Solução de Cotações Mágicas Mais Curtas

Estou escrevendo um aplicativo que precisa ser portátil. Eu sei que devo desativar aspas mágicas na configuração do PHP, mas neste caso não sei se posso fazer isso, então estou usando o seguinte código: if (get_magic_quotes_gpc() === 1) { ...

3 a resposta

Wrapper de classe C ++ em torno de tipos fundamentais

Muitas bibliotecas que eu vi / usei typedefs para fornecer variáveis portáteis e de tamanho fixo, por exemplo, int8, uint8, int16, uint16, etc, que terão o tamanho correto, independentemente da plataforma (e o c ++ 11 faz isso com o cabeçalho ...

7 a resposta

Como projetar uma biblioteca C / C ++ para ser utilizável em muitos idiomas do cliente? [fechadas]